Selected Biography

Roe, Eric Robert – Born: Church Eaton, Staffordshire on 2.4.1921.[1]  Parents: Eli Percy Roe of Adbaston, Staffordshire (Farmer) and Rosa May [née Ellsmoor].  Home: Orslow, Newport, Church Eaton, Staffordshire (1921), Rodbridge Farm, Rodbridge, Long Melford (1939).  Occupation: Farmer’s Assistant (1939).  Married: Florence Elfreda Barbara Rutterford in 1951.  Service Record: Eric was a member of the ‘H’ Company, 10th Battalion, Suffolk Home Guard when it was formed in August 1942.  His name is recorded in the official tribute to the organization entitled The Lion Roared his Defiance, photographed in and around Long Melford in 1944.[2]  Died: Boston, Lincolnshire on 1.6.1999.

Notes – [1] 1939 Register.  [2] Published by Marten & Son, Ltd., of Market Hill, Sudbury, Suffolk in 1946.
